Stu M wrote:
Have a look at his tries and assists. As good as Field and French are the acid test is the NRL is it not?

I’ll wager a charity bet that Welsby will be playing in the NRL before either of them do again. There’s a reason why they are here and not in the NRL.

Welsby is the best player in SL whether you like it or not.


Anybody would be silly to not admit that Welsby is one of the best players in Superleague but is he the best? I don't think anybody could say that with a great deal of confidence. I think it's quite close between Welsby, Williams and French IMO and given the silly MOS voting system, Lachlan Lam may well walk away with the official award for 2023. It's interesting to look at trys and assists combined for those 4 guys and you can throw in Jai Field as well. If we're saying trys and assists are what a top level fullback or halfback will be judged on, 2 players are clear of the rest on that score when worked out on an average per game-

Welsby- Games-25 Trys-10 Assists-26 Combined T/A Avg per game-1.44
French- Games-25 Trys-16 Assists-28 Combined T/A Avg per game-1.76
Field-Games-19 Trys-14 Assists-19 Combined T/A Avg per game-1.74
Lam-Games-25 Trys-8 Assists-21 Combined T/A Avg per game-1.16
Williams-Games-21 Trys-11 Assists-19 Combined T/A Avg per game-1.43

Pretty good numbers from all 5 but 2 guys stand out above the rest. Those stats aren't the be all and end all of any argument about who is the best player in the league but If I compared Welsby to just Field, I'd be interested to know what puts Welsby ahead of him as being the best player in the league? (so not just better than Field but better than everyone else as well). He doesn't contribute as much per game as Field in terms of trys and assists and I would be pretty confident in saying Field is a better fullback defensively, so what is it that puts him clear? Personally I think French is the best player in the league but maybe I'm biased.

In many ways it’s a pointless argument. No Saints fan would swap Welsby for French/Field and no Wigan fan would swap French/Field.

I knew when I posted Welsby’s stats that French had better stats but I only referred to them as a comeback to a fan on here that described him as “average” which is laughable.

Also stats don’t paint the full picture. French scored 7 tries in one game this season didn’t he? The Hull game or was that last season? He’s also played games on the wing which would increase his tally too.

It’s all subjective but the only part I’m trying to point out is that there’s talk in Aus about clubs wanting to sign Welsby yet no one seems to really want to sign French or Field. I’m sure both are happy at Wigan but let’s have it right had they the chance to go back to the NRL they would’ve gone like a shot. As would Sironen and Matautia at Saints.

If we use the NRL as a yardstick for ability and competition then Welsby is more sought after than French or Field. I think there’s a reason for that.
